サイトアイコン Lonely Mobiler

デフォルトシェルが zsh なのに tmux 起動すると bash が動く

普段 Shell には zsh を利用しているのに、なぜか tmux を起動すると bash になってしまうという問題が発生した。

この問題を解決するには ~/.tmux.conf へ以下の一行を追加し、tmux を再起動すると良い。

set-option -g default-shell /bin/zsh

tmux を再起動する際は裏で動いてるのも全て落とす必要があるっぽいので pkill や killall コマンドなど使って確実に落とそう。

Sponsored Link
モバイルバージョンを終了